Custom paper sizes?

Former Member
Former Member over 13 years ago

My local B size (11x17") has been having issues so I try to print to a

network printer (HP 5si mopier). Trouble is that the list of paper sizes

that comes up in Eagle 5's print dialog does not include Tabloid - which is

what the printer wants to see for this size paper. The ...dialog box to the

right side of paper select is grayed out.

 

Is there a way to get "tabloid" to be one of the menu choices?

    Hi Oppie,

     

    You can't get tabloid as one of the paper choices, but what you can do

    is print to PDF. The PDF printer allows you to set a custom paper size

    and it will likely pickup all of the paper sizes from the printer driver.

    Finally got it to work the way I needed.

    Was using a networked HP laserjet mopier 5si printer that is served through

    a network printserver. Just could not get it to print properly on 11x17".

    The Ah-Ha moment was in remembering that it used to work until the

    printserver was migrated to another resource. Dang admin won't allow any

    changes so had to do plan B.

     

    Got the IP address of the printer and created a new printer port through

    windows XP (local standard TCP port).

    Tried several drivers but the one that did work properly with Eagle was

    downloaded from HP (lj632.exe) and extracted to a temp file so the .inf was

    available. Upon installing, use "have disk" option and point to the inf

    file.

    Choose "HP LaserJet 5si/5si MX PS" for the driver.

    I now have all access to setup since it is essentially a local printer and

    set the trays to letter and 11x17"

     

    Now prints beautifully.  Hope that this will help anybody having similar

    problems.

    I'm still using Eagle 5 and Windows 7 Pro SP1.  I had the same issue.  If you select Print to PDF and enter in the custom size of 11inch x 17inch (Don't Hit Print) THEN go back and select your printer it will leave the size in the box.  Then just hit PRINT.  Kind of a hassle, but it lets you print directly from Eagle to a B size 11x17 inch sheet without having to save it to a PDF.  Hope that helps.  I had to play with Landscape and Portrait settings but that's how I print all my drawings now.
